The Girls Profession Fittings
I recommend this store every chance I get. They are located in Harrisonville, MO and make the process of buying bras and swimwear painless and something that you get to look forward to. They are open by appointment and this guarantees getting one on one service. You don’t feel rushed or pressured to buy more than what you need and you can even create a wish list to reference the next time you come in. They also have jeans and clothes that you can purchase from their website, https://thegirlsfittings.com/
